jsp做网站用到的软件到底选啥?老站长掏心窝子分享,别再花冤枉钱

jsp做网站用到的软件到底选啥?老站长掏心窝子分享,别再花冤枉钱

jsp做网站用到的软件

做建站这行七年了,见多了那种一上来就问“jsp做网站用到的软件”的兄弟。说实话,每次看到这种问法,我心里都咯噔一下。为啥?因为大多数问这个的人,要么是想省成本自己折腾,要么是被外包坑怕了想找替代品。但不管咋说,选对工具真的能省下一半的头发。

我刚开始入行那会儿,也是啥都不懂,听人说Java厉害,JSP更厉害,于是硬着头皮搞。那时候用的IDE是Eclipse,配置环境配得我想砸电脑。现在回想起来,那是真·纯手工劳动,没有任何捷径。你要是现在还想用Eclipse搞大型项目,我劝你趁早打消这个念头,除非你特别怀旧,或者公司服务器老得只能跑旧版本。

现在主流且好用的jsp做网站用到的软件,首推IntelliJ IDEA。这玩意儿虽然吃内存,但智能提示真的香。记得有次给客户改个订单模块,代码几千行,乱得像团麻。用IDEA搜了一下,瞬间定位到问题所在,那感觉就像在沙漠里找到了水源。当然,IDEA有社区版和专业版,社区版免费但功能少点,专业版要钱。要是你预算紧,社区版对付一般小站也够用了,毕竟咱们做中小企业官网,不用搞什么微服务架构,简单粗暴最有效。

除了编辑器,数据库工具也得跟上。MySQL是标配,连接数据库我用的是Navicat。这软件收费不便宜,但为了那点自动备份和可视化的方便,我觉得值。有回半夜两点,客户说网站打不开了,我远程连上去一看,数据库表锁死了。要是没这工具,我得去敲命令行查日志,估计客户早骂娘了。现在点几下鼠标,锁表释放,网站恢复,客户那语气立马变了,从“你怎么搞的”变成“还是你专业”。这就是工具的价值,虽然它不能帮你写代码,但它能救命。

还有版本控制,Git必须得装。别跟我说你记性好,代码改了十版你肯定记不住哪版是最新的。我用的是GitLab,自己搭的私有库,安全又自在。每次提交代码前,我都会习惯性写个注释,比如“修复首页加载慢bug”。有时候回头看这些注释,就像看自己的成长日记,挺有意思的。

说到jsp做网站用到的软件,很多人忽略了服务器部署这块。Tomcat是绕不开的坎。新手最容易栽在端口冲突和路径配置上。我有个朋友,第一次部署JSP项目,Tomcat启动报错,他查了半天日志,最后发现是JDK版本和Tomcat版本不匹配。那种挫败感,懂的都懂。所以,在选jsp做网站用到的软件时,一定要确认好兼容性问题。别等到代码写完了,跑不起来,那才叫绝望。

另外,前端部分虽然JSP主要处理后端逻辑,但现在前后端分离是大趋势。如果你还要用JSP做页面展示,建议搭配一些轻量级的模板引擎,比如Thymeleaf,虽然它更多用于Spring Boot,但理念相通,比直接写JSP标签页要清爽得多。当然,如果坚持用传统JSP,记得把HTML和Java代码尽量分开,别写成一锅粥,否则后期维护起来,你自己都想删库跑路。

最后想说,工具只是辅助,核心还是你的逻辑思维和对业务的理解。别迷信什么神器,适合自己的才是最好的。我见过用记事本写JSP的大神,也见过用IDEA还写出一堆Bug的新手。所以,别纠结选哪个软件,先把手头的活儿干漂亮。当你遇到瓶颈时,回过头看看,也许你会发现,真正让你进步的,不是那个软件,而是你一次次debug后那种“终于通了”的快感。

总之,jsp做网站用到的软件选IDEA加Navicat加Git,基本能应付大部分场景。别整那些花里胡哨的,能跑起来、好维护、少加班,就是好软件。希望这篇大实话能帮到正在纠结的你,少走点弯路,早点下班。

网站建设 企业官网 数字化转型